About the Creator
Public art - The Color Of Palo Alto - Recently reviewed by The NYTimes - http://web.mac.com/refusalon/Site_1/N_Y_Times_08.html Glass making, glass /video/art production - 1978 - Current. Director - refusalon Gallery, San Francisco, CA - 1994 - 2012 Managed all operations and sales. Curated and collaboratively curated a program of monthly openings and other art events featuring regional, national and international artists. Managed and conducted sales to individual, corporate and museum collectors. Established budgets, strategy, planning, direction, funding; managed staff, implementation and installations. Showed Dale Chihuly (solo) and Sol Lewit (solo). Fostered relations with media and was regularly reviewed by art media worldwide. Participated in major international shows/fairs.
